Ordner und Dateien (mittig) teilweise umbennenen und kürzen

German support forum

Moderators: Hacker, Stefan2, white

Post Reply
calculate
Junior Member
Junior Member
Posts: 3
Joined: 2008-10-22, 19:51 UTC

Ordner und Dateien (mittig) teilweise umbennenen und kürzen

Post by *calculate »

Hallo,

ich möchte mit dem MUT, wenn es geht, Dateien und Ordner umbennen, bekomme das aber einfach nicht hin.

Problem: Die Namen (Dateien bzw. Ordner) sind teilweise zu lang (max <= 39.3 bzw <= 39 Zeichen)

1. Die Namen sollen jetzt auf maximal 39 Zeichen (Dateien dann + .ext) verkürzt werden.
2. Die ersten 30 Zeichen und die letzten 7 Zeichen sollen mit .. verbunden werden, aber nur wenn der gesamte Name länger als 39 Zeichen ist.

Also [n1-30]..[n-7-]. Funktioniert aber leider nicht wenn die Namen kürzer sind, dann habe ich nämlich Teile doppelt.

Weiß vielleicht jemand, wie ich das hinbekommen könnte?

calculate
User avatar
Hacker
Moderator
Moderator
Posts: 13142
Joined: 2003-02-06, 14:56 UTC
Location: Bratislava, Slovakia

Post by *Hacker »

Hallo calculate,
Num+

Code: Select all

<.{39,}
Enter, Strg-M, ...

HTH
Roman
Mal angenommen, du drückst Strg+F, wählst die FTP-Verbindung (mit gespeichertem Passwort), klickst aber nicht auf Verbinden, sondern fällst tot um.
calculate
Junior Member
Junior Member
Posts: 3
Joined: 2008-10-22, 19:51 UTC

Post by *calculate »

Danke für die Antwort Roman, aber verstanden habe ich die Zeichenfolge nicht. Na ja, ich werde es mal ausprobieren.

Edit:
Habe eine Erkärung der RegEx-Zeichen gefunden.
Aber bedeutet die obige Zeichenfolge nicht, - wähle alle Namen aus, die weniger als 39 Zeichen haben?

ciao. calculate
User avatar
sqa_wizard
Power Member
Power Member
Posts: 3895
Joined: 2003-02-06, 11:41 UTC
Location: Germany

Post by *sqa_wizard »

Aber bedeutet die obige Zeichenfolge nicht, - wähle alle Namen aus, die weniger als 39 Zeichen haben?
"<" bedeutet nicht "kleiner" sondern nur "Dies ist eine RegEx" !
"." bedeutet beliebiges Zeichen
"{39,}" bedeutet: kommt mindestens 39 mal vor
#5767 Personal license
calculate
Junior Member
Junior Member
Posts: 3
Joined: 2008-10-22, 19:51 UTC

Post by *calculate »

Danke für die Erklärung.
Das mit den RegEx-Zeichen hatte ich ja gefunden, aber wo finde ich denn z.B. die Erklärung vom "<"-Symbol oder eventuellen weiteren Funktionen?
Das steht nicht bei den Erklärungen zu den RegEx.

ciao. calculate
User avatar
Hacker
Moderator
Moderator
Posts: 13142
Joined: 2003-02-06, 14:56 UTC
Location: Bratislava, Slovakia

Post by *Hacker »

calculate,
wo finde ich denn z.B. die Erklärung vom "<"-Symbol oder eventuellen weiteren Funktionen?
Das steht nicht bei den Erklärungen zu den RegEx.
Das steht in der Hilfe unter "Selecting files" (sorry, habe nur die englische parat). Dorthin gelangt man über:
- File operations - Selecting files, oder
- Mark - Menu entries to mark files - Selecting files.

HTH
Roman
Mal angenommen, du drückst Strg+F, wählst die FTP-Verbindung (mit gespeichertem Passwort), klickst aber nicht auf Verbinden, sondern fällst tot um.
Post Reply